#f54583 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f54583 is composed of 96.1% red, 27.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 338.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#f54583 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#eb0007.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#f54583 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f54583 has RGB values of R:245, G:69,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.47,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16074115.

Shades and Tints of #f54583

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#feedf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f54583

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2989c is the less saturated color, while #fd3d81 is the most saturated one.
